EX PARTE SMITH

1001102.

832 So.2d 89 (2001)

Ex parte Navada DeWayne SMITH. (In re Navada Dewayne Smith v. State of Alabama).

Supreme Court of Alabama.

September 14, 2001.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

J. William Cole of Luker, Cole & Associates, L.L.C., Birmingham, for petitioner.

Bill Pryor, atty. gen., and Stephen N. Dodd, asst. atty. gen., for respondent.


LYONS, Justice.

Navada DeWayne Smith was convicted of trafficking in cocaine, a violation of § 13A-12-231(2)a., Ala.Code 1975, and failure to affix tax stamps, a violation of § 40-17A-4, Ala.Code 1975. Smith was sentenced to serve concurrent terms of imprisonment—10 years on the trafficking conviction and 1 year on the failure-to-affix conviction.
